Primary Responsibilities
  • Take responsibility for the entire design process from the Proposal through preparation of the plans, specifications and estimate of a moderate to large transit project or projects
  • Plan, direct and monitor all aspects of large multidiscipline projects or medium-sized projects with high degree of technical complexity, typically in excess of $5 million and involving a large project staff
  • Produce and coordinate several projects concurrently
  • Support and lead project pursuits, prepare proposals, scopes and fee estimates.
  • Establish client relations and be involved with marketing, contractual, design and production meetings
  • Conduct schematic, design development and contract document work sessions at project sites in conjunction with Project Managers, appropriate technical professionals and other disciplines
  • Coordinate staffing and workload through entire project development to complete documents on schedule
  • Work with the Business/Accounting Manager, Project Controller or Company Controller and Department Manager or Managing Principal for project reviews
  • Implement QA/QC procedures
  • Execute training for personnel as established by strategic plans
  • Supervise large project staffs and act as mentor for less-experienced Project Managers
  • Maintain professional engineering registration
  • Perform other duties as needed
Preferred Qualifications
  • Demonstrated ability to manage multiple projects and personnel
  • Experience with designing transit facilities such as stations, parks and rides, transit centers, and operations and maintenance facilities.
  • Solid business development skills with history of winning projects as the proposed project manager or task lead
  • Demonstrated ability to relate well to clients
  • Demonstrated presentation skills
  • Preference given to local candidates
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ree
  • A minimum of 10 years experience in all aspects of roadway engineering design
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license
  • Demonstrated leadership skills, communication skills and ability to work with various teams
  • Project management skills desirable
  • Experience should include urban and rural highway interchanges, intersection design, traffic management, transportation planning, site planning, preparation of concept alignments, geometrical layout and CAD base alignment plans
  • Must have coordinated survey, grading, drainage and utilities and layout of various site items is a plus
  • An attitude and commitment to being an active participant of our employee-owned culture is a must
